Residential Roofing Services

Every homeowner knows the importance of taking good care of their home. There are some things you can do to protect your home against harm, and paying attention to your roofing will go a long way in ensuring that you maintain its new look. Any small roofing problems can lead to expensive repairs. And so it is important hire professional roofing companies to fix such problems before they turn into complex ones. Roofing Toronto professionals have the necessary skills, expertise and experience to handle any kind of roofing problem. This article highlights the major roofing services offered by roofing contractors.


Your roof is the first line of defense against harsh weather and so it is important to choose a roof that can withstand the harshest weather conditions. A roof repair Toronto professional is highly trained on all aspects of roofing and so will help you choose the right roofing material for your home, be it shingles, wood shakes, rubber roof or metal roof. There are some ways to tell if your roof needs replacement. These include:

  • Missing shingles
  • Water damage on the ceiling
  • Light filtering through
  • High heating or cooling bills

If you notice any of these problems, you should call roofing contractors to replace your roof. In addition to protecting your home against
harsh weather conditions, having a stable roof offers many other benefits. A good roof will offer greater insulation and reduce the amount of energy required to moderate temperatures in the house during summer or winter, making them energy-efficient. Moreover, a new roof will increase the aesthetic value of your home.


Whether you want to install a new eavestrough or replace an old one in your home, an eavestrough system is a very important element of roofing. Roofing contractors specialize in innovative eavestrough solutions to make life easier and increase property value. Benefits on having a new eavestrough system installed in your home include:

  • Protecting the home against infiltration of water, snow and ice
  • Preventing erosion
  • Reducing mosquito propagation
  • Eliminating periodic maintenance

The strength and durability of an eavestrough is determined by the reliability of the fastener. Therefore, choose a roof repair Toronto
company with a reliable and rugged fastening system that can secure the eavestrough to your home. Eavestroughs tend to get clogged with paper, leaves or debris which may make them to overflow into the backfilled area. To prevent this, you should have your eavestrough cleaned regularly. Our professional roofing contractors are trained to clean eavestroughs easily and quickly.


Another important roofing service provided by roofing Toronto providers is siding repair and replacement. As siding ages, it usually fades to a less vibrant color and begins to retain a dirty appearance. Replacing your siding will enhance your curb appeal thanks to the variety of colors, profiles and textures available. Any hidden structural damage will also be repaired in the process, preventing more costly repairs that you may encounter later. Roofing repair Toronto professionals will also add house wraps while replacing siding in order to keep winter winds out of bay. This will increase energy efficiency.

Snow and Ice Removal

Heavy winter precipitation is often associated with a lot of snow and ice which can put unnecessary strain on your roof. Moreover, the heat coming from the house can melt the snow to form ice dams, when the temperatures cool down. This can significantly damage your roofing materials. This is where roof snow removal comes in handy. Some homeowners often prefer the DIY approach whenever any home project comes up, but this is a dangerous process that is better left to professionals. Our company have the proper expertise, experience and equipment to remove snow and ice from your roof. This will not only prevent your roof from damage but will also save you from the costly accidents associated with slippery roof.

Emergency services

Sometimes your roofing may develop problems even in the middle of the night as a result of harsh weather conditions or any other reason. In such cases, you would want to have an urgent and temporary solution as you make arrangements for a more permanent repair. Roofing companies offer emergency services to deal with any roofing problem that requires urgent attention. So if a section of your roof gets damaged after heavy rains, just call roof repair Toronto providers and they will respond promptly.

Thinking of installing skylights? Read about benefits of skylights installation.

Your Name (required)

Your Email (required)



Our Service Areas: Toronro, Mississauga, Brampton, Markham, Vaughan and Richmond Hill